WebABSTRACT: Johannes Müller’s law of specific nerve energies (LOSNE) states that the mind has access not to objects in the world but only to our nerves. This law implies that the contents of the mind have no qualities in common with environmental objects but serve only as arbitrary signs or markers of those objects. The law of specific nerve energies, first proposed by Johannes Peter Müller in 1835, is that the nature of perception is defined by the pathway over which the sensory information is carried. … WebThetheory wasthat eachsensory nerve had its characteristic type ofactivity so that the optic nerve would signal light andcolor, the auditorynervethequality ofsound, the olfactory nervethat ofodor, andso on. Thistheoryis vividly expressed bythestatement, "Ifwecouldcross the auditory andoptic nerves, wecould see thunderandhearlightning.""
